About this Item

A Chinese famille-rose 'Phoenix and Dragon' barrel seat, 19th century
the front and reverse decorated with two rondels of phoenixes and five-clawed dragons enclosed by a yellow ground, enamelled with bats, lotus blooms and foliage with further medallions of Buddhist emblems and dogs-of-fo, the top and lower half with pink enamelled bosses, the sides and seat pierced with cash, 48cm high

Provenance

The Andrew Newall Collection.
